Javascript自动下载页面加载文件

2666

Ant Design Vue - Melca

在页面最初显示时,会首先下载页面内容以及所需的CSS和JavaScript,这样在页面加载时用户可以最快获得外观的反馈。 由于内容通常都是文本,有利于在传输过程中压缩,因此给用户以更快的响应。 这样做的好处在于:无论在什么地方加载file1.js,都不会阻塞和影响页面其他内容的加载,当然,会影响HTTP请求。一般情况下,通过动态节点下载脚本文件时,file1.js被加载完毕之后,往往会立即执行(除了FF和Opera,他们会等待此前的所有动态节点脚本执行完毕)。 上面的代码加载了3个外部文件,每个文件在加载的过程中阻塞了页面的解析,浏览器只有等待它们下载并运行了Javascript代码之后,页面才能继续,这我们在上面已经提到过了。 文件下载是一个Web中非常常用的功能,不过你是做内部管理系统还是做面向公众的互联网公司都会遇到这个问题,对于下载一般有点实际开发经验的都会自己解决,上周弄了一下多文件下载,业务场景就是一条数据详细信息一个附件原来只需要一个pdf就行,现在要求添加两张图片,一次性的下载出来 由于代码是在